Motorist Gets Out of Car, Beats a Bicyclist and Gets Back

#ad▼

Elk Grove Village police responded about 4:33 p.m. Thursday of a battery near the intersection of Biesterfield Road and Meacham Road. Police received a report from a third party that the driver of a Ford Taurus got out of his car and beat a bicyclist. The driver then got back in his car and drove away. Police spotted the Ford Taurus within about two minutes and stopped the vehicle at Biesterfield and Columbia.

Apparently the bicyclist did not wish to be seen by police. No word on whether the driver of the Ford Taurus was arrested.
